/kernel/linux/linux-6.6/drivers/gpio/ |
H A D | gpio-lpc18xx.c | 168 irq_hw_number_t hwirq; lpc18xx_gpio_pin_ic_domain_alloc() local [all...] |
H A D | gpio-em.c | 245 em_gio_irq_domain_map(struct irq_domain *h, unsigned int irq, irq_hw_number_t hwirq) em_gio_irq_domain_map() argument
|
H A D | gpio-uniphier.c | 263 irq_hw_number_t hwirq; in uniphier_gpio_irq_domain_alloc() local 217 uniphier_gpio_irq_get_parent_hwirq(struct uniphier_gpio_priv *priv, unsigned int hwirq) uniphier_gpio_irq_get_parent_hwirq() argument
|
/kernel/linux/linux-6.6/drivers/pinctrl/mediatek/ |
H A D | mtk-eint.c | 101 static int mtk_eint_flip_edge(struct mtk_eint *eint, int hwirq) in mtk_eint_flip_edge() argument [all...] |
/kernel/linux/linux-6.6/drivers/pci/controller/ |
H A D | pci-xgene-msi.c | 126 static u32 hwirq_to_reg_set(unsigned long hwirq) in hwirq_to_reg_set() argument 131 static u32 hwirq_to_group(unsigned long hwirq) in hwirq_to_group() argument 136 static u32 hwirq_to_msi_data(unsigned long hwirq) in hwirq_to_msi_data() argument 162 static int hwirq_to_cpu(unsigned long hwirq) in hwirq_to_cpu() argument 167 hwirq_to_canonical_hwirq(unsigned long hwirq) hwirq_to_canonical_hwirq() argument 226 u32 hwirq; xgene_irq_domain_free() local [all...] |
H A D | pcie-rockchip-host.c | 514 u32 hwirq; in rockchip_pcie_legacy_int_handler() local 670 rockchip_pcie_intx_map(struct irq_domain *domain, unsigned int irq, irq_hw_number_t hwirq) rockchip_pcie_intx_map() argument
|
/kernel/linux/linux-6.6/drivers/pci/controller/mobiveil/ |
H A D | pcie-mobiveil-host.c | 342 mobiveil_pcie_intx_map(struct irq_domain *domain, unsigned int irq, irq_hw_number_t hwirq) mobiveil_pcie_intx_map() argument
|
/kernel/linux/linux-6.6/drivers/pci/controller/dwc/ |
H A D | pcie-uniphier.c | 212 uniphier_pcie_intx_map(struct irq_domain *domain, unsigned int irq, irq_hw_number_t hwirq) uniphier_pcie_intx_map() argument
|
/kernel/linux/linux-6.6/drivers/gpu/drm/msm/ |
H A D | msm_mdss.c | 97 irq_hw_number_t hwirq = fls(interrupts) - 1; in msm_mdss_irq() local 144 msm_mdss_irqdomain_map(struct irq_domain *domain, unsigned int irq, irq_hw_number_t hwirq) msm_mdss_irqdomain_map() argument
|
/kernel/linux/linux-6.6/drivers/irqchip/ |
H A D | irq-gic-v2m.c | 100 static phys_addr_t gicv2m_get_msi_addr(struct v2m_data *v2m, int hwirq) in gicv2m_get_msi_addr() argument 168 static void gicv2m_unalloc_msi(struct v2m_data *v2m, unsigned int hwirq, in gicv2m_unalloc_msi() argument 182 int hwirq, offse in gicv2m_irq_domain_alloc() local 135 gicv2m_irq_gic_domain_alloc(struct irq_domain *domain, unsigned int virq, irq_hw_number_t hwirq) gicv2m_irq_gic_domain_alloc() argument [all...] |
H A D | irq-renesas-rzg2l.c | 189 unsigned int hwirq = irqd_to_hwirq(d); in rzg2l_tint_set_edge() local 260 irq_hw_number_t hwirq; in rzg2l_irqc_alloc() local [all...] |
H A D | irq-sp7021-intc.c | 81 static void sp_intc_assign_bit(u32 hwirq, void __iomem *base, bool value) in sp_intc_assign_bit() argument 102 u32 hwirq = d->hwirq; in sp_intc_ack_irq() local 124 u32 hwirq = d->hwirq; sp_intc_set_type() local 171 int hwirq; sp_intc_handle_ext_cascaded() local 195 sp_intc_irq_domain_map(struct irq_domain *domain, unsigned int irq, irq_hw_number_t hwirq) sp_intc_irq_domain_map() argument [all...] |
H A D | irq-bcm7038-l1.c | 137 int hwirq; in bcm7038_l1_irq_handle() local [all...] |
H A D | irq-ls-scfg-msi.c | 197 int pos, size, hwirq; in ls_scfg_msi_irq_handler() local 243 int virq, i, hwirq; in ls_scfg_msi_setup_hwirq() local 290 int i, hwirq; in ls_scfg_msi_teardown_hwirq() local [all...] |
H A D | irq-loongson-pch-pic.c | 155 pch_pic_domain_translate(struct irq_domain *d,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) pch_pic_domain_translate() argument 188 unsigned long hwirq; pch_pic_alloc() local [all...] |
H A D | irq-mvebu-icu.c | 200 unsigned long hwirq; in mvebu_icu_irq_domain_alloc() local 151 mvebu_icu_irq_domain_translate(struct irq_domain *d,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) mvebu_icu_irq_domain_translate() argument [all...] |
H A D | irq-vic.c | 220 u32 stat, hwirq; in vic_handle_irq_cascaded() local 184 vic_irqdomain_map(struct irq_domain *d, unsigned int irq, irq_hw_number_t hwirq) vic_irqdomain_map() argument
|
/kernel/linux/linux-5.10/drivers/gpio/ |
H A D | gpio-bcm-kona.c | 468 int hwirq = GPIO_PER_BANK * bank_id + bit; in bcm_kona_gpio_irq_handler() local 522 bcm_kona_gpio_irq_map(struct irq_domain *d, unsigned int irq, irq_hw_number_t hwirq) bcm_kona_gpio_irq_map() argument
|
H A D | gpio-rcar.c | 143 unsigned int hwirq = irqd_to_hwirq(d); in gpio_rcar_irq_set_type() local 104 gpio_rcar_config_interrupt_input_mode(struct gpio_rcar_priv *p, unsigned int hwirq, bool active_high_rising_edge, bool level_trigger, bool both) gpio_rcar_config_interrupt_input_mode() argument [all...] |
H A D | gpio-tegra186.c | 492 tegra186_gpio_irq_domain_translate(struct irq_domain *domain,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) tegra186_gpio_irq_domain_translate() argument 541 tegra186_gpio_child_to_parent_hwirq(struct gpio_chip *chip, unsigned int hwirq, unsigned int type, unsigned int *parent_hwirq, unsigned int *parent_type) tegra186_gpio_child_to_parent_hwirq() argument
|
/kernel/linux/linux-5.10/arch/powerpc/platforms/8xx/ |
H A D | cpm1.c | 130 unsigned int sirq = 0, hwirq, eirq; in cpm_pic_init() local
|
/kernel/linux/linux-5.10/arch/powerpc/platforms/powernv/ |
H A D | pci.c | 168 int hwirq; in pnv_setup_msi_irqs() local 215 irq_hw_number_t hwirq; in pnv_teardown_msi_irqs() local [all...] |
/kernel/linux/linux-5.10/arch/arm/mach-omap2/ |
H A D | omap-wakeupgen.c | 514 irq_hw_number_t hwirq; in wakeupgen_domain_alloc() local 487 wakeupgen_domain_translate(struct irq_domain *d,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) wakeupgen_domain_translate() argument [all...] |
/kernel/linux/linux-6.6/arch/arm/mach-omap2/ |
H A D | omap-wakeupgen.c | 515 irq_hw_number_t hwirq; in wakeupgen_domain_alloc() local 488 wakeupgen_domain_translate(struct irq_domain *d, struct irq_fwspec *fwspec, unsigned long *hwirq, unsigned int *type) wakeupgen_domain_translate() argument [all...] |
/kernel/linux/linux-6.6/arch/powerpc/platforms/pseries/ |
H A D | msi.c | 560 int hwirq; in pseries_irq_domain_alloc() local 535 pseries_irq_parent_domain_alloc(struct irq_domain *domain, unsigned int virq, irq_hw_number_t hwirq) pseries_irq_parent_domain_alloc() argument [all...] |